In recent years, people pay more and more attention to nosie and vibration caused by urban rail transit. With the large-scale construction of urban rail transit, vibration and noise reduction is gradually becoming a problem to be solved urgently. Experts and scholars at home and abroad have done a lot of research about the source of vibration and the route of vibration transmission. In this paper, metro vehicle-track coupling system is taken as the research object. The research contents focus on the dynamic characteristics and vibration transmission of railway track structure. The research mainly includes the following aspects:1) Based on the theory of vehicle-track coupling dynamics, this article establishes4track systems including general track bed, vibration absorber fastening track, LVT track and ladder-shaped sleepers track and compares there dynamic characteristics. Meanwhile, vibration mitigation effect is analyzed using following3indexes:vibration level,1/3octave, transfer function.etc. Gauss white-noise method is used to analyze frequency domain response of structure.2) This thesis analyses some factors that influence the dynamic response of track system. Speed, fastener stiffness, fastener space and track irregularity are considered for general track bed track system. Rubber hardness and rubber angle are considered for vibration absorber fastening track system. Fastener stiffness and stiffness under sleeper are considered for LVT track and ladder-shaped sleepers track system.3) According to the problems produced in practical application, this article proposes some corresponding optimizations and compares its response.The work done in this paper can give some suggestions for metro track structure selection, and give some references for parameter design of vibration-control track system.
